What Truly Defines a Reliable Source for UV-Blocking Engraving Sheets

A truly dependable supplier of UV-blocking engraving sheets goes far beyond a glossy catalog or quick shipping promises. It starts with material integrity—look for sheets that specify the exact UV-blocking wavelength range and have consistent optical density across the entire surface, not just a spot test. Real reliability means the sheet won’t delaminate under heat from a laser, or discolor after a few months in indirect sunlight. A source that willingly provides spectral transmission graphs and third-party test data, rather than marketing jargon, is one that understands the demands of serious engraving work.

Production consistency is another hallmark. Many shops can send you a perfect sample, but a trustworthy source maintains that quality across multiple batches, thicknesses, and sheet sizes. This requires rigorous in-house quality checks—look for suppliers that document their thickness tolerance, surface hardness, and UV additive dispersion uniformity. Without these, your engraving outcomes become a gamble: one sheet may cut cleanly while the next leaves melty residue or uneven char. A source that treats every order as if it’s going into a safety-critical application—like protective signage or medical device panels—will give you peace of mind.

Finally, the human element often separates the genuine experts from box-shifters. A knowledgeable supplier will ask about your laser wattage, engraving speed, and anticipated environmental exposure, then recommend a sheet formulation that actually fits your use case rather than pushing the most expensive option. They understand that UV-blocking isn’t a one-size-fits-all feature—outdoor signage needs different additives than display case windows. This depth of application insight, paired with transparent communication about lead times, minimum order quantities, and custom cutting services, defines a source you can build a long-term partnership with.

How Top-Tier UV Resistance Prevents Fading and Cracking Over Time

When materials are exposed to sunlight day after day, ultraviolet radiation slowly breaks down their chemical bonds. This process, called photodegradation, doesn't just dull the surface—it weakens the entire structure. Colors start to wash out, and tiny micro-cracks begin to form. Without proper protection, that vibrant finish and structural integrity quickly become a memory.

Premium UV-resistant formulations work by absorbing or reflecting harmful rays before they can do damage. Think of it as an invisible shield that sacrifices itself so the material doesn't have to. High-grade inhibitors neutralize free radicals as they form, preventing the chain reaction that leads to brittleness and discoloration. The result is a surface that stays rich in color and physically sound, even after years of relentless exposure.

The Overlooked Link Between Material Purity and Crisp Engraving Results

When engraving intricate designs, artisans often blame tool sharpness or machine calibration for subpar results, but the purity of the material itself plays a far greater role than most realize. Trace impurities—such as sulfides in brass or silicon veins in aluminum—create microscopic hard spots that deflect the cutting tip inconsistently, leaving fuzzy edges instead of crisp lines. Even minute variations in alloy composition can alter thermal conductivity during laser engraving, causing uneven vaporization and a mottled finish. Without addressing this foundational factor, no amount of technical finesse can fully salvage the crispness of the final piece.

The relationship between material purity and engraving clarity becomes evident when comparing identical settings across different batches of the same metal. A 99.5% pure copper sheet may yield flawless results, while a 99% pure counterpart riddled with oxygen or iron inclusions produces jagged outlines and irregular depths. This inconsistency forces operators into a cycle of trial and error, constantly readjusting speed and power, unaware that the underlying cause lies in the material’s provenance. Suppliers rarely highlight these distinctions, yet they directly determine whether a design emerges razor-sharp or disappointingly dull.

For those seeking consistently crisp engravings, scrutinizing material certifications is not pedantic—it is essential. Demanding mill test reports that specify trace element percentages can reveal potential pitfalls before the first pass. In practice, investing in higher-purity stock often reduces waste and rework, offsetting the initial cost. Beyond metals, the same principle applies to acrylics and woods, where filler content and resin quality dictate how cleanly a laser beam severs the surface. Ultimately, the purity of the medium is the silent partner in every successful engraving, one that deserves as much attention as the tools that shape it.

Why Batch-to-Batch Consistency Matters More Than a One-Time Perfect Sample

It’s easy to get excited about a flawless prototype—that one perfect unit that nails every spec and feels like a breakthrough. But in manufacturing, a single golden sample is little more than a promise. What truly separates reliable suppliers from the rest is whether the millionth piece off the line performs exactly like the first. Consistency across batches isn’t just a quality metric; it’s the backbone of trust, operational efficiency, and long-term cost control.

Inconsistent batches create a cascade of problems downstream. Assembly lines jam, tolerances drift, and returns spike. Even when defects are caught early, the rework and scrap quietly erode margins while engineers scramble to trace root causes. Over time, this variability chips away at a brand’s reputation, because customers experience your product, not your inspection report. A single amazing sample can’t compensate for the unpredictability that follows.

Building batch-to-batch consistency demands more than tight specs on a datasheet. It’s a discipline woven into every step—from raw material sourcing to tooling maintenance and operator training. Smart factories invest in statistical process control and real-time monitoring, but the real differentiator is a culture that treats slight deviations as emergencies, not nuisances. Because in the end, a product is only as good as its most inconsistent batch, and that one perfect sample is just a snapshot in a much longer film.

What makes UV resistance so critical in engraving plastic for long-term applications?

Outdoor and high-exposure uses like machinery tags, electrical panels, and architectural signage demand decades of readability. UV-stabilized plastics prevent the breakdown of polymer chains that causes brittleness, fading, and surface cracking. Cheap alternatives might look fine initially but fail within a couple of years under sunlight, compromising safety and brand image.

How can I evaluate a supplier’s capability before committing?

Request a paid sample run that mimics your full production process—same thickness, colorants, and engraving settings. Check for burr-free cuts, uniform pigment dispersion, and whether the material becomes tacky under the laser. Also ask to tour their extrusion facility (in person or virtually) to see their quality checks and raw material storage conditions.
